1. Safety Introductions
WARNING
Please keep this User Manual for future consultation. If you sell the fixture to another
user, be sure that they also receive this instruction booklet.
Unpack and check carefully there is no transportation damage before using the fixture.
Before operating, ensure that the voltage and frequency of power supply match the
power requirements of the fixture.
It’s important to ground the yellow/green conductor to earth in order to avoid electric
shock.
Disconnect main power before servicing and maintenance.
Use safety chain when fixes this fixture. Don’t handle the fixture by taking its head only,
but always by taking its base.
Maximum ambient temperature is Ta : 40℃. Don’t operate it where the temperature is
higher than this.
In the event of serious operating problem, stop using the fixture immediately. Never try
to repair the fixture by yourself. Repairs carried out by unskilled people can lead to
damage or malfunction. Please contact the nearest authorized technical assistance
center. Always use the same type spare parts.
Do not connect the device to any dimmer pack.
Do not touch any wire during operation and there might be a hazard of electric shock.
To prevent or reduce the risk of electrical shock or fire, do not expose the fixture to rain
or moisture.
The housing must be replaced if they are visibly damaged.
Do not look directly at the LED light beam while the fixture is on.

2. Technical Specifications
Input Voltage: 220-240 Vac / 50-60 Hz
Power consumption: 15W
Light Source: 9W (3 in 1) LED
Fuse: T 3A (AC 230/250V)
7 DMX Channels
Dimension: 285 x 240 x 280 mm
Net Weight: 2.6kg
Cross Weight: 3.15kg
3. Installation
The unit should be mounted via its screw holes on the bracket. Always ensure that the unit is
firmly fixed to avoid vibration and slipping while operating. Always ensure that the structure
to which you are attaching the unit is secure and is able to support a weight of 10 times of
the unit’s weight. Also always use a safety cable that can hold 12 times of the weight of the
unit when installing the fixture.
The equipment must be fixed by professionals. And it must be fixed at a place where is out
of the touch of people and has no one pass by or under it.

5. How To Control The Unit
Two ways to operations:
A. Master/Slave operation
B. Universal DMX controller
A. By Master/slave Built-in Preprogrammed Function
By linking the units in master/slave connection, the first unit(Master)must be turned Dip
switch 9 on,then will control the others to give a coordinate automatic light show and it’s
good for instant shows. In this mode, the other unit(Slave)must be turned Dip switch 10 on.
The first unit is easy to recognize by nothing in its DMX input jack. The others of chains
(Slave) will have DMX cables plugged into the DMX input jacks (daisy chain).

5A
B. By universal DMX controller
When using a universal DMX controller to control the chain of units, you have to set DMX
address by Dip switches from 1 to 8 to make sure all the units will receive its DMX signal.
Please refer to the following diagram to know how to address your DMX 512 system in the
binary code.

6. DMX512 Configuration
Channel Value Function
1
0-3 Off
4-127 Clockwise fast to slow
128-255 Counter Clockwise slow to fast
2 0-255 Red dimmer
3 0-255 Green dimmer
4 0-255 Blue dimmer
5
0-27 Off
28-55 3 colors fade without rotation
56-111 7 colors fade without rotation
112-139 7 colors change with rotation
140-167 7 colors jump with rotation
168-195 3 colors fade with rotation
196-251 7 colors fade with rotation
252-255 Sound active
6 0-255 Color change speed from slow to
fast(when CH5 on 28-111)
7 0-255 Strobe from slow to fast

7. DMX512 Connections
The DMX512 is widely used in intelligent lighting control, with a maximum of 512 channels.
1. If you using a controller with 5 pins DMX output, you need to use a 5 to 3 pin
adapter-cable.
2. Connect the fixture together in a “daisy chain” by XLR plug cable from the output
of the fixture to the input of the next fixture. The cable cannot be branched or
split to a “Y” cable. Inadequate or damaged cables, soldered joints or corroded
connectors can easily distort the signal and shut down the system
3. The DMX output and input connectors are pass-through to maintain the DMX
circuit when one of the units’ power is disconnected.
4. At last fixture, the DMX cable has to be terminated with a terminator to reduce
signal errors. Solder a 120-ohm 1/4W resistor between pin 2(DMX-) and pin
3(DMX+) into a 3-pin XLR-plug and plug it in the DMX-output of the last fixture.
5. Each lighting fixture needs to have an address set to receive the data sent by
the controller. The address number is between 0-511 (usually 0 & 1 are equal to
1).
6. 3 pin XLR connectors are more popular than 5 pin XLR.
3 pin XLR: Pin1: GND, Pin2: Negative signal (-), Pin3: Positive signal (+)
5 pin XLR: Pin1: GND, Pin2: Negative signal (-), Pin3: Positive signal (+)
Pin4/5: Not Used.

8. Troubleshooting
Following are a few common problems that may occur during operation. Here are some
suggestions for easy troubleshooting:
A. The fixture does not work, no light
1. Check the connection of power and main fuse.
2. Measure the mains voltage on the main connector.
B. Not responding to DMX controller
1. DMX LED should be on. If not, check DMX connectors, cables to see if link properly.
2. If the DMX LED is on and no response to the channel, check the address settings and
DMX polarity.
3. If you have intermittent DMX signal problems, check the pins on connectors or on PCB
of the fixture or the previous one.
4. Try to use another DMX controller.
5. Check if the DMX cables run near or run alongside to high voltage cables that may
cause damage or interference to DMX interface circuit.
C. Some fixtures don’t respond to the easy controller
1. You may have a break in the DMX cabling. Check the LED for the response of the
master/ slave mode signal.
2. Wrong DMX address in the fixture. Set the proper address.
D. No response to the sound
1. Make sure the fixture does not receive DMX signal.
2. Check microphone to see if it is good by tapping the microphone.
E. One of the channels is not working well
1. The stepper motor might be damaged or the cable connected to the PCB is broken.
2. The motor’s drive IC on the PCB might be out of condition.

9. Fixture Cleaning
The cleaning of internal must be carried out periodically to optimize light output. Cleaning
frequency depends on the environment in which the fixture operates: damp, smoky or
particularly dirty surrounding can cause greater accumulation of dirt on the fixture’s optics.
Clean with soft cloth using normal glass cleaning fluid.
Always dry the parts carefully.
Clean the external optics at least every 20 days. Clean the internal optics at least every
30/60 days.
